How do you calculate the average atomic mass for neon if its abundance in nature is 90.5% neon-20, 0.3% neon-21, and 9.2% neon-22?

To calculate the atomic weight you form the sum of mole fractions of isotope times isotopic mass:

20.18=20*0.905+21*0.003+22*0.092

To be more accurate you must use the exact isotopic weights of each isotope, which are not exactly 20,21 and 22., plus there are other isotopes as well.
